Specialties At the Hotel Republic San Diego, Autograph Collection, you will find yourself surrounded by distinctive and trendy accommodations in San Diego, California. Our luxury hotel places you in the heart of downtown, near the Gaslamp Quarter and Little Italy, with easy access to Petco Park and the San Diego Convention Center. In addition, we offer exquisite on-site dining at Trade, our hotel restaurant, a 24-hour gym and a business center.

Beach-themed boutique hotel embodies the Gaslamp's urban oasis vibe with a fitness center, two cocktail lounges and a pan-Asian restaurant. – In Short Following a multi-million dollar makeover in summer 2008, The W's beach-chic theme is more vibrant than ever. Updates are evident in the lobby's Living Room lounge, where classic surfer films play on one large wall, a lifeguard stand doubles as a DJ deck and an art installation of fiberglass surfboard fins fills the ceiling.
